Rivian projects 2026 vehicle deliveries of 62,000‑67,000 units, setting its delivery guidance for the year.
Adjusted EBITDA is forecast as a loss between $2.10 bn and $1.80 bn, with capital expenditures of $1.95‑$2.05 bn.
Gross profit fell due to a $100 m drop in automotive regulatory credit sales and a shift toward commercial vans.
Software and services revenue rose 49% YoY, and Rivian began R2 production while securing a $1 bn Volkswagen investment.
